There is indeed a Window-Eyes mailing list. Just go to the support link on the G W Micro website and go to the mailing lists link and subscribe from there. As for your other problem, it just means that the browse mode buffer has loaded. Just press shift, plus control, plus A and you'll hear a clicking sound and then you can write your e-mail without a problem. Don't know why it does that but I've got so used to doing it now that I just don't think about it.
